Sawtooth National Forest Fire Danger & Restrictions
Fire danger is extreme across much of the Sawtooth National Forest, with Stage 1 restrictions in place. Campfires are prohibited in backcountry and dispersed areas but allowed in developed campgrounds and picnic sites with permanent fire structures. Propane and liquid fuel stoves are permitted with clearance requirements. Always check current conditions and specific ranger district regulations before your trip.
